Your Committee on Public Safety and Military Affairs, to which was referred S.B. No. 2043, S.D. 1, entitled:
"A BILL FOR AN ACT MAKING AN APPROPRIATION TO THE AVIATION MUSEUM OF THE PACIFIC,"
begs leave to report as follows:
The purpose of this measure is to appropriate funds, as yet unspecified, for the restoration and exhibits of a new air museum to be built on Ford Island, Oahu.
The measure further provides that such funding is subject to the Military Aviation Museum of the Pacific providing an unspecified amount for this purpose Your Committee defers to your Committee on Finance to determine the appropriate amounts to insert into the measure.
Your Committee finds that a new Military Aviation Museum of the Pacific will not only showcase United States military aviation in the Pacific, but will also perpetuate the important role of aviation in our country's history. The planned museum will memorialize the events (i.e. the U.S.S. Arizona, the U.S.S. Missouri, and the U.S.S. Bowfin) that occurred during the attack on Pearl Harbor, as well as pay tribute to our country's efforts in the South Pacific and Asia.
As affirmed by the record of votes of the members of your Committee on Public Safety and Military Affairs that is attached to this report, your Committee is in accord with the intent and purpose of S.B. No. 2043, S.D. 1, and recommends that it pass Second Reading and be referred to the Committee on Finance.
